Geneva or New York: which climate?

Geneva (Switzerland) has a warm-summer humid continental climate, whereas New York (United States) has a hot-summer humid continental climate, according to the Köppen-Geiger classification.

The values compared here are normals computed over 86 complete calendar years, from 1940 to 2025, using ERA5 reanalysis data from the Copernicus programme. The same method and the same period apply to Geneva and to New York.

New York is warmer than Geneva by 3.5 °C in annual average: 12.1 °C against 8.6 °C.

Geneva gets more rain than New York: 1,405 mm per year against 1,098 mm.

Geneva has warmed by +3.0 °C between 1940 and 2025, against +1.7 °C in New York. Geneva is therefore warming faster than New York. Both trends are statistically significant.

Geneva averages 2 hot days (≥ 30 °C) and 100 frost days per year; New York averages 20 and 75.

Data from ERA5 reanalysis (Copernicus Climate Change Service), redistributed under a CC-BY 4.0 licence. Normals are recomputed whenever the archive is updated.

IndicatorGenevaNew YorkDifference
Mean daily temperature8.6 °C12.1 °C+3.5 °C
Average daily high12.9 °C15.7 °C+2.8 °C
Average daily low4.5 °C8.6 °C+4.1 °C
Annual rainfall1,405 mm1,098 mm-307 mm
Sunshine / day8.9 h8.8 hnegligible
Hot days (≥ 30 °C)2 d/yr20 d/yr+18 d/yr
Frost days (< 0 °C)100 d/yr75 d/yr-25 d/yr
Rainy days (≥ 1 mm)161 d/yr118 d/yr-43 d/yr
Mean relative humidity78 %71 %-7 %
Average peak wind9.6 km/h17.4 km/h+7.8 km/h

A difference is only reported when it exceeds the resolution of the data. ERA5 is a reanalysis on a grid of about 31 km: two nearby cities often fall in the same cell, and below half a degree you are reading the grid, not the climate.
